If your pain doesn't enhance with self-care steps, your doctor may recommend some of the following treatments (best treatment for sciatica). The types of drugs that may be prescribed for sciatica discomfort consist of: Anti-inflammatories Muscle relaxants Narcotics Tricyclic antidepressants Anti-seizure medications Once your acute discomfort enhances, your doctor or a physiotherapist can create a rehab program to help you prevent future injuries.
In many cases, your doctor may suggest injection of a corticosteroid medication into the location around the included nerve root. Corticosteroids help in reducing discomfort by reducing inflammation around the irritated nerve. The results normally subside in a couple of months. sciatica treatment at home. The variety of steroid injections you can receive is restricted since the danger of major side results increases when the injections take place too frequently.
Surgeons can eliminate the bone spur or the part of the herniated disk that's continuing the pinched nerve. For many people, sciatica reacts to self-care steps. Sciatica is pain that starts in your lower back and shoots down through your legs and in some cases into your feet. It takes place when something in your body-- maybe a herniated disk or bone spur compresses your sciatic nerve. Some people experience sharp, extreme discomfort, and others get tingling, weakness, and pins and needles in their legs.
Most people with sciatica do not end up needing surgery, and about half get much better within 6 weeks with only rest and medication. So what do you need to do after your doctor makes a diagnosis of sciatica?Most individuals with sciatica get much better in a few weeks with at-home remedies. sciatica in pregnancy treatment. If your pain is fairly moderate and it isn't stopping you from doing your daily activities, your medical professional will first recommend trying some combination of these standard solutions.

Lots of individuals believe that alternative therapies like yoga, massage, biofeedback, and acupuncture help with sciatica. Yourfirst alternative must be over the counter painkiller. Acetaminophen and NSAIDs( n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s) like aspirin, ibuprofen, and naproxen are extremely useful, but you shouldn't utilize them for extended durations without talking withyour medical professional. Tricyclic antidepressants such as amitriptyline( Elavil )and anti- seizure medications often work, too.
Steroid injections directly into the irritated nerve can also supply you with minimal relief. Whenall else stops working, surgery is the last hope for about 5% to 10% of individuals with sciatica. If you have milder sciatica however are still in pain after 3 months of resting, extending, and taking medication, you and your medical professional most likely will have to talk about surgical treatment. That's a straight-to-surgery scenario. The two primary surgical options for sciatica are diskectomy and laminectomy - treatment sciatica. During this procedureyour surgeon eliminates whatever is pressing on your sciatic nerve, whether it's a herniated disk, a bone spur, or something else. The goal is to remove just the piece that's in fact triggering the sciatica, but often surgeons need to get rid of the entire disk to fix the problem. Here are 6 workouts that do just that: reclining pigeon posesitting pigeon poseforward pigeon poseknee to opposite shouldersittingback stretchstanding hamstring stretchPigeon pose is a common yoga posture. There are several variations of this stretch. The very first is a beginning version known as the reclining pigeon pose. If you're just starting your treatment, you should try the reclining pose initially. While on your back, bring your ideal leg up to a best angle. Clasp both hands behind the thigh, locking your fingers. Hold the position for a minute.
This assists extend the tiny piriformis muscle, which sometimes becomes irritated and presses against the sciatic nerve, causing pain. Do the exact same workout with the other leg. Once you can do the reclining version without discomfort, work with your physiotherapist on the sitting and forward versions of pigeon present.
